Award Win For Arrow Stunts

One of the most ambitious, action-heavy episodes of Arrow to date was recognised with a Leo Award to Eli Zagoudakis and Jeffrey Robinson for Best Stunt Co-ordination for The Slabside Redemption, directed by James Bamford.

Amidst rioting inmates and with Ricardo Diaz targeting him for death, Oliver must protect the guards and defeat Diaz in an epic showdown, using only the resources around him.

The episode was brutal and intense and used all levels of the set. It featured a combination of high falls and burns, explosions, hand-to-hand combat and athletic leaps. In one scene Oliver used a soda can in a pillowcase as an effective weapon.
